Farmingdale - DII Weekend Recap (10/6 & 10/7)
The Farmingdale State Rams DII hockey team went 1-1 in their two games played over the past weekend. They suffered their first loss of the season on Friday night when they visited Stony Brook's DIII team. The Seawolves erupted out of the gate with three unanswered goals, two of which were scored by Nikita Vorotnikov. Colin Cross scored the only Rams goal of the period at 2:11 to cut the lead down to two heading into the first intermission. However, Stony Brook again went on a 3-0 scoring run to take a commanding 6-1 lead over the Rams. Bobby Lane and Brendan Dixson both scored later in the game to bring it to a 6-3 final score.
The University of New Haven's DIII team provided another tough test for the Rams on Saturday. Peter Abazis scored the game's first goal and got Farmingdale off to a good start. But the Chargers responded with two of their own to take a 2-1 lead into the second. From there, the Rams went on a 4-0 scoring run through the start of the third period. Cross and Dixson scored two apiece on this run to give the Rams a 5-2 lead. Facing a three-goal deficit, New Haven did not go away quietly. Chad Feola scored at 15:04 and Michael Pilato scored at 11:56 in the third to come within one goal of tying the game. Despite the high-pressure situation, the Rams stayed composed and held the Chargers at bay to take a 5-4 victory.
